Organize your schedule and life’s important events in a calendar that’s fully integrated with your Thunderbird or Seamonkey email. Manage multiple calendars, create your daily to do list, invite friends to events, and subscribe to public calendars.

Rainlendar is a feature rich calendar application that is easy to use and doesn't take much space on your desktop. The application is platform independent so you can run it on all major operating systems: Windows, Linux and Mac OS X.

Morgen merges your calendars, to-dos, productivity apps, and schedulers, so you manage all your time in one place. With Morgen as your time management hub, you’ll stop wasting time flipping between calendars, apps, and browser tabs, and just get work done.

The most popular app to view all your calendars like Google, Live, Outlook, iCloud, Exchange, Office365, Facebook and more. OneCalendar integrates all your calendars into an easy-to-read overview. View and manage all your appointments, events and birthdays.
